## Runbook: export timezone verification

Before promoting a Hollowfen release, confirm report exports render in each tenant's configured timezone rather than UTC — check the smoke tenant in a non-UTC zone and compare against the preview pane. If any offset mismatch appears, halt the rollout. Verified bundles must then be re-signed for distribution. The signing key for export bundles is provided below.

signing key of yajog-kafof = bky19_orbYRY3Abj3KpZesMie

## Configuration

The 4.2 release of Quarrelstone introduced a query planner regression where hash joins were chosen over index scans on the ledger tables. Until the patched planner ships in 4.2.3, force the legacy planner via the override flag in the service env file. Note that the override endpoint requires authentication against the planner control plane, so the env file must also carry its credential. Add the following line to conf/planner.env before rolling the canary:

secret setting of hawep-yahig: LEDGER_TOKEN29=41b5d6315371c92885eaeb077fb63

## Onboarding: Dependency Pinning at Lanternworks

All third-party dependencies are pinned to exact versions in the lockfile; ranges are prohibited in release branches. The release manager approves pin updates weekly after the vulnerability scan completes. Updated lockfiles must be signed before they enter the build cache, and the verifier rejects anything unsigned. Sign lockfile commits with the key provided below.

signing key of bagap-yawep = bky13_TbfT6ZMUoGJo2

TURN-208: Gatevale turnstile counters at the Merrow Field pilot double-count when a rotation reverses mid-cycle. Attendance totals drift roughly 2% high per event. The debounce window fix is implemented, reviewed by Ilsa, and soak-tested across two simulated match days without drift. Ready for your cut; the candidate build is identified below.

trace token, tagag-tafog: htk6_5ed18c